Job Description

Start your development journey with MPAC as a Junior Systems Developer in Pickering, ON. Get hands-on experience in a collaborative team environment focused on impactful IT solutions. MPAC is looking for ten motivated new grads to fill a permanent role involving cutting-edge technologies and methodologies.

This position provides the opportunity to engage in full-stack development, utilize open-source tools, and learn from experienced engineers. You will contribute to meaningful projects that serve Ontario’s municipalities. Key Responsibilities:

  • Design and implement user interfaces with technical guidance
  • Write well-structured, documented code in collaboration with seniors
  • Analyze systems for proposed enhancements and impacts
  • Build and test prototypes to validate concepts
  • Maintain thorough documentation of existing systems Requirements:
  • Recent deg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or similar
  • Familiar with front-end technologies like React and TypeScript
  • Knowledge of Object-Oriented Programming principles
  • Experience with Python or Rust preferred
  • Excellent problem-solving and communication abilities Join MPAC to apply your programming knowledge and drive valuable outcomes for communities.
